I don't know about you guys, but I've had issues with hoses not hanging right on the shop bought stands. So I came up with an extension. I gave the design to my dad that does some metal work and he totally over engineered this thing.

The problem.
The hose pulls the guns to an angle if you use two guns at a time but it's not too bad if you only use one.

The solution.
Extension arm that can swivels.
Like I said, totally over engineered but it will last me a life time. This one is stainless steel.

Swings out of the way.

Hose hang straight down and actually brings the gun closer as well. When done, swing away.
